Steve Hill
Before entering the petroleum industry, Steve Hill earned a PhD in astrophysics and was a professor at Michigan State University. Steve was a 25-year employee at Conoco, serving primarily in seismic processing-related functions. Steve was manager of Conoco's seismic processing center. Steve created his first seismic processing course in 1979. In his current role as an adjunct associate professor at Colorado School of Mines, Steve teaches the CSM seismic processing course.
Steve also contributes to the SEG, having served as the SEG Secretary/Treasurer and Finance Committee Chair. Steve is currently the Publications Policy Committee chair, member of the Publications Committee, Geophysicsassociate editor, and TLE special editor. Steve authors the bi-monthly TLE column Geophysics Bright Spots.
